Sharjah vs Prachuap Khiri Khan Climate & Distance Between

Thailand flag
  • The distance between Sharjah, United Arab Emirates and Prachuap Khiri Khan, Thailand is approximately 4,878 km or 3,031 mi.
  • To reach Sharjah in this distance one would set out from Prachuap Khiri Khan bearing 294.4°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Sharjah bearing 279.5° or W .
  • Sharjah has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Prachuap Khiri Khan has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ry summers (As).
  • Sharjah is in or near the subtropical desert biome whereas Prachuap Khiri Khan is in or near the tropical moist forest biome.
  • The mean temperature is 0.8 °C (1.4°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 12.6 °C (22.7°F) more in Sharjah.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1047.1 mm (41.2 in) less which is equivalent to 1047.1 l/m² (25.7 US gal/ft²) or 10,471,000 l/ha (1,119,419 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 8.4° lower in Sharjah than in Prachuap Khiri Khan.
